Setting up MT5 for S&P500 options from Botswana is straightforward. First, download the MT5 platform from your broker's website or the Apple App Store / Google Play Store. Install and launch the application. Use the login credentials provided by your broker after account approval. In the Market Watch window, right-click and select 'Symbols' — search for 'US500' or 'SPX' (depending on the broker's naming). Add the instrument to your watchlist. For options, ensure your broker supports CFD options or plain vanilla options on the index. Open a chart, set your preferred timeframe (e.g., 1-hour for intraday or daily for swing trading). Use the 'Trade' tab to select 'Options' if available, or trade via the standard order window. Test your internet connection speed; a minimum of 5 Mbps is recommended for stable execution. Verify your broker's server time — most use GMT+2 or GMT+3, which aligns with Botswana's CAT time (GMT+2).

S&P500 CFDs vs Futures

Botswana traders debating S&P500 exposure should understand the differences between CFDs, futures, and spot options. CFD options on the S&P500 are the most accessible — they require lower capital, offer flexible leverage, and avoid the complexities of physical delivery. Futures options, on the other hand, trade on exchanges like the CME, have fixed contract sizes (e.g., 1 contract = $250 x index value), and require higher margin. Spot options (direct index options) are not typically available to retail traders due to regulatory restrictions. For Botswana traders, CFDs are preferable because they can be traded on MT5 with small lot sizes (0.01), accept local payment methods, and offer 24/5 trading. However, CFDs carry counterparty risk and may have wider spreads. Futures offer transparent pricing and no counterparty risk but demand larger initial outlay. Consider your capital, risk tolerance, and strategy: CFDs suit smaller accounts and active trading, while futures suit larger accounts or hedging needs.

Best trading times - S&P500 from Botswana

The best trading times for S&P500 options from Botswana align with the US cash market session. Botswana is in Central Africa Time (CAT, GMT+2), which means the US pre-market begins at 14:30 CAT, the regular session opens at 15:30 CAT, and closes at 22:00 CAT. The most liquid period is between 15:30 and 18:00 CAT, when both US and European markets overlap. For options traders, the first hour after the open (15:30-16:30 CAT) offers the highest volatility and volume, ideal for day trading. The last hour (21:00-22:00 CAT) often sees volatility due to position squaring. Avoid the lunch period (18:00-19:30 CAT) when liquidity thins. Major economic releases like the US Non-Farm Payrolls (first Friday, 14:30 CAT) create sharp moves. Botswana traders should use an economic calendar set to CAT and plan trades around these sessions for optimal execution.

Key economic events - Botswana

Key economic events that affect S&P500 volatility include the US Non-Farm Payrolls (NFP) report, released on the first Friday of each month at 14:30 CAT. The Federal Reserve's FOMC interest rate decision occurs eight times a year, typically at 20:00 CAT. The US Consumer Price Index (CPI) data is released around 14:30 CAT on the second or third week of the month. Other important events include the ISM Manufacturing PMI (first business day, 16:00 CAT) and the University of Michigan Consumer Sentiment (second Friday, 16:00 CAT). Botswana traders should mark these on their calendar in CAT. During these releases, S&P500 options premiums spike, and execution can be erratic. Avoid trading 15 minutes before and after the release unless you have a specific strategy. Use an economic calendar app (e.g., Forex Factory) set to CAT. For longer-term options, pay attention to quarterly earnings seasons (mid-Jan, mid-Apr, mid-Jul, mid-Oct) as individual stocks drive index moves.

Islamic accounts & swap fees - Botswana

Swap or overnight interest charges apply to CFD positions held past 5 PM EST (11 PM CAT). For S&P500 options, if you hold a short or long CFD position overnight, you pay or receive swap based on the interest rate differential. Botswana traders seeking Islamic (swap-free) accounts can request one during registration. These accounts do not charge overnight interest, making them suitable for longer-term options strategies like LEAPS. However, swap-free accounts may have a holding period limit (e.g., 30 days) or restrictions on options expiry. Some brokers also charge an administration fee after a certain number of days. Always check the broker's swap-free policy. Note that swap-free accounts may not be available for all account types (e.g., ECN). For Botswana traders who hold positions for weeks, a swap-free account is ideal to avoid cumulative swap costs. For day traders, swap charges are negligible.

Risk management - Botswana

Risk management is critical for Botswana traders trading S&P500 options on MT5. The S&P500 can move 1-2% intraday, which translates to significant gains or losses on options due to leverage. Always use stop-loss orders — for options, set a stop on the underlying CFD or a fixed monetary loss. Never risk more than 1-2% of your account on a single trade. Botswana traders should be aware of currency risk: your account is in USD, but your local expenses are in BWP. A strengthening USD amplifies losses. Use position sizing tools in MT5, such as the 'Trade' size calculator. Avoid over-leveraging; most brokers offer up to 1:30 for major indices, but 1:10 is safer. Keep a trading journal to review performance. Consider using a demo account to test strategies before real money. Also, understand that options have time decay (theta) — short-term options lose value quickly. Diversify across different strikes and expiries to manage risk.

Scam warnings - Botswana

Botswana traders must be vigilant against scams promising guaranteed S&P500 options returns. Unregulated brokers or 'signal providers' that ask for upfront fees or require deposits to cryptocurrency wallets are red flags. Always verify a broker's license with NBFIRA or a reputable offshore regulator like the FCA (UK), CySEC (Cyprus), or ASIC (Australia). Avoid brokers that refuse to provide a physical address or have no customer support during Botswana business hours. Be cautious of unsolicited offers via WhatsApp or social media — these are common in Botswana. Never share your MT5 account password with anyone. Use only the official MT5 platform from the broker; avoid third-party modifications. If a broker promises 'risk-free' options trading or 'guaranteed' payouts, it is a scam. Report suspicious activity to NBFIRA. Legitimate brokers will always warn about the high risk of losing money when trading options.

Deposits & Withdrawals - Botswana

Botswana traders can fund their S&P500 options accounts using several methods. Bank Transfer is reliable but slow (2-5 business days) and may incur intermediary fees. Credit Cards (Visa/Mastercard) are instant but often have a 2-3% fee. Skrill and Neteller offer instant deposits with low fees (0-1%) and are widely used for forex/CFD trading. USDT (Tether) is popular due to zero fees and instant processing, but requires a crypto wallet. All deposits are processed in USD; your bank in Botswana may convert BWP to USD at their rate. Withdrawals follow the same methods — bank transfers take 1-3 business days, Skrill/Neteller are instant, and USDT is near-instant. Some brokers require the same method for deposit and withdrawal (e.g., if you deposited via Skrill, you must withdraw via Skrill). Minimum withdrawal is typically $10. Botswana banks have no restrictions on these transfers, but amounts over $10,000 may require declaration. Always check the broker's fee schedule — some charge a withdrawal fee (e.g., $10 for bank transfer).

How to Open a Account in Botswana

Opening a business brokerage account for S&P500 options in Botswana is a streamlined process. First, choose a regulated broker that accepts Botswana corporate entities. Provide your business registration certificate (e.g., from CIPA), proof of business address (utility bill or bank statement dated within 3 months), and identification for all directors (Omang cards or passports). Some brokers also require a memorandum of understanding or board resolution authorizing trading. Complete the online application on the broker's website. You will need to upload scanned copies of documents. The verification process typically takes 1-3 business days. Once approved, fund your account via Bank Transfer, Credit Card, Skrill, Neteller, or USDT. Minimum deposit for a business account is usually higher — $100 to $500 USD. After funding, download MT5 and log in with the credentials provided. Ensure your business tax number (from BURS) is registered with the broker for compliance. Some brokers offer dedicated account managers for business clients.
